from setuptools import setup
import sys
import os
if os.environ.get('distutils_issue8876_workaround_enabled', False):
# sdist_hack: Remove reference to os.link to disable using hardlinks when
# building setup.py's sdist target. This is done because
# VirtualBox VMs shared filesystems don't support hardlinks.
del os.link
NAME = 'easyprocess'
PYPI_NAME = 'EasyProcess'
URL = 'https://github.com/ponty/easyprocess'
DESCRIPTION = 'Easy to use python subprocess interface.'
PACKAGES = [NAME,
NAME + '.examples',
]
# get __version__
__version__ = None
exec(open(os.path.join(NAME, 'about.py')).read())
VERSION = __version__
extra = {}
if sys.version_info >= (3,):
extra['use_2to3'] = True
classifiers = [
# Get more strings from
# http://pypi.python.org/pypi?%3Aaction=list_classifiers
"License :: OSI Approved :: BSD License",
"Natural Language :: English",
"Operating System :: OS Independent",
"Programming Language :: Python",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 2",
# "Programming Language :: Python :: 2.3",
# "Programming Language :: Python :: 2.4",
#"Programming Language :: Python :: 2.5",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 2.6",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 2.7",
# "Programming Language :: Python :: 2 :: Only",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3",
# "Programming Language :: Python :: 3.0",
# "Programming Language :: Python :: 3.1",
# "Programming Language :: Python :: 3.2",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3.3",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3.4",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3.5",
]
setup(
name=PYPI_NAME,
version=VERSION,
description=DESCRIPTION,
long_description=open('README.rst', 'r').read(),
classifiers=classifiers,
keywords='subprocess interface',
author='ponty',
# author_email='',
url=URL,
license='BSD',
packages=PACKAGES,
**extra
)
